تشریح مفهوم بهینه سازی و بکارگیری آن در الگوریتمهای جستجو
تشریح مفهوم بهینه سازی و بکارگیری آن در الگوریتمهای جستجو
بهینه سازی
الگوریتمهای جستجو
سیستم های نرم افزاری
بهینه سازی الگوریتمهای جستجو
بهینه سازی سیستم های نرم افزاری
تشریح مفهوم بهینه سازی و بکارگیری آن در الگوریتمهای جستجو
دانلود پایان نامه کامپیوتر
دانلود پایان نامه رشته نرم افزار
دانلود پایان نامه مهندسی نرم افزار
تشریح مفهوم بهینه سازی و بکارگیری آن در الگوریتمهای جستجو
*آپدیت:ضمیمه کردن مقاله ترجمه شده با عنوان Metaheuristics in Combinatorial Optimization در قالب 42 صفحه بصورت رایگان:)
قابل توجه مشتریان عزیز:هم فایل انگلیسی و هم فارسی ضمیمه شده است.
چكیده
بهینهسازی یك فعالیت مهم و تعیینكننده در طراحی ساختاری است. طراحان زمانی قادر خواهند بود طرحهای بهتری تولید كنند كه بتوانند با روشهای بهینهسازی در صرف زمان و هزینه طراحی صرفهجویی نمایند. بسیاری از مسائل بهینهسازی در مهندسی، طبیعتاً پیچیدهتر و مشكلتر از آن هستند كه با روشهای مرسوم بهینهسازی نظیر روش برنامهریزی ریاضی و نظایر آن قابل حل باشند.
بهینهسازی تركیبی (Combinational Optimization)، جستجو برای یافتن نقطه بهینه توابع با متغیرهای گسسته (Discrete Variables) میباشد. امروزه بسیاری از مسائل بهینهسازی تركیبی كه اغلب از جمله مسائل با درجه غیر چندجملهای (NP-Hard) هستند، به صورت تقریبی با كامپیوترهای موجود قابل حل میباشند. از جمله راهحلهای موجود در برخورد با این گونه مسائل، استفاده از الگوریتمهای تقریبی یا ابتكاری است. این الگوریتمها تضمینی نمیدهند كه جواب به دست آمده بهینه باشد و تنها با صرف زمان بسیار میتوان جواب نسبتاً دقیقی به دست آورد و در حقیقت بسته به زمان صرف شده، دقت جواب تغییر میكند.
کلمات کلیدی:
بهینه سازی
الگوریتمهای جستجو
سیستم های نرم افزاری
مقدمه
هدف از بهینهسازی یافتن بهترین جواب قابل قبول، با توجه به محدودیتها و نیازهای مسأله است. برای یك مسأله، ممكن است جوابهای مختلفی موجود باشد كه برای مقایسه آنها و انتخاب جواب بهینه، تابعی به نام تابع هدف تعریف میشود. انتخاب این تابع به طبیعت مسأله وابسته است. به عنوان مثال، زمان سفر یا هزینه از جمله اهداف رایج بهینهسازی شبكههای حمل و نقل میباشد. به هر حال، انتخاب تابع هدف مناسب یكی از مهمترین گامهای بهینهسازی است.
در این گزارش ابتدا به بررسی تعاریف مختلف بهینه سازی پرداخته و سپس تعریف مورد قبول که پایه بخشهای بعدی قرار میگیرد انتخاب می شود. سپس به معرفی تکنیک های مورد استفاده در سیستم های نرم افزاری پرداخته و تمرکز مطالب بر روی تکنیک جستجو قرار می گیرد. یکی از (و قطعاُ مهمترین) مفاهیم مطرح در تحقیق عملیات مفهوم بهینه سازی است. بهینه سازی را میتوان تخصیص منابع به مصارف به بهترین شکل ممکن تعریف کرد. نکته اساسی در این تعریف رسیدن به بهترین تخصیص ممکن است، بطوریکه تخصیصی بهتر از آن وجود نداشته باشد. استفاده از روشهای اولیه بهینه سازی شامل برنامه ریزی خطی ، برنامه ریزی عدد صحیح ، برنامه ریزی پویا ، و برنامه ریزی غیر خطی با مشکلاتی همراه بود و مهمترین این مشکلات وقت¬گیر بودن حل مسائل بزرگ با آنها بود.
به گونه ای که حتی با تکنولوژیهای محاسباتی پیشرفته امروزی حل یک مساله با ابعاد وسیع با تکنیکهای ذکر شده به چندین سال زمان نیاز دارد. بروز این مشکل به توهماتی که در ابتدای شکل گیری دانش تحقیق در عملیات، مبنی بر حل بهینه تمام مسائل دنیا با استفاده از این دانش، ایجاد شده بود پایان داد. بروز این مشکل، همچنین، سبب شد محققان مجبور به تعدیل انتظارات خود از این دانش جدید در یافتن بهترین جواب ممکن شوند و به جوابهایی به اندازه کافی خوب، که حتی درمورد مسائل با ابعاد بزرگ نیز در مدت زمان منطقی میتوان به آنها رسید، اکتفا کنند.
فهرست مطالب
فصل اول:بهینه سازی و انواع آن
چكیده
. مقدمه
هدف
بررسی روشهای جستجو و بهینهسازی
شكل ـ : طبقه بندی انواع روشهای بهینه سازی
روشهای شمارشی
روشهای محاسباتی (جستجوی ریاضی یا Based Method Calculus)
مسائل بهینه سازی تركیبی (Optimization Problems Combinational)
روش حل مسائل بهینهسازی تركیبی
آزادسازی
تجزیه
تكرار
روش تولید ستون (Column Generation)
جستجوی سازنده (Constructive Search)
جستجوی بهبود یافته (Improving Search)
روش جستجوی همسایه ( NS= Neighbourhood Search)
روشهای فرا ابتكاری (Metaheuristic) برگرفته از طبیعت
معرفی
مسأله فروشنده دوره گرد (Travelling Salesman Problem = TSP)
انواع روشهای فرا ابتكاری برگرفته از طبیعت
الگوریتم ژنتیك
آنیلینگ شبیهسازی شده
شبکههای عصبی
جستجوی ممنوع
سیستم مورچه (Ant System)
فصل دوم: سیستم های نرم افزاری و بهینه سازی آنها
. انواع سیستم های نرم افزاری
. مقدمه
. انواع سیستم های نرم افزاری
. . سیستم تصمیم یار(DSS)
. . . ویژگیها و قابلیتهای DSS
. . . زیرسیستم های DSS
. . سیستم خبره
. . . ساختار سیستم های خبره
. بهینه سازی در سیستم های رابطه ای
. . مروری بر پردازش پرس و جو
. . بهینه سازی پرس و جو
فصل سوم: جستجو
. . روشهای جستجوی ساخت یافته
. . . جستجوی اول بهترین
. . . . کمینه کردن هزینه تخمینی برای رسیدن به یک هدف : جستجوی حریصانه
. . . . کمینه کردن هزینه کل مسیر: جستجوی A*
. . . جستجو با حافظه محدود
. . . . جستجوی A* عمقی تکراری (IDA*)
. . . . جستجوی A* ساده شده با محدودیت حافظه SMA*))
. . . الگوریتم های بهبود تکرار شونده
. . . الگوریتم ژنتیک
. . جستجوی توزیع شده (الگوریتمهای جستجو در عاملها)
. . . تعریف مساله ارضای محدودیت (CSP)
. . . الگوریتم تصفیه
. . . الگوریتم سازگاری برمبنای فرااستدلال
. . . عقبگرد آسنکرون
. . . جستجوی الزام ضعیف آسنکرون
. . مساله یافتن مسیر
. . . تعریف مساله یافتن مسیر
. . . برنامه نویسی پویای آسنکرون
. . . A* بی درنگ یادگیر(LRTA*)
. . . A* بی درنگ(RTA*)
. . . جستجوی هدف متحرک(MTS)
. . . جستجوی دوطرفه بی درنگ(RTBS)
. . . جستجوی چندعامله بی درنگ
. . بازیهای دو نفره
. . . فرموله کردن بازیهای دو نفره
. . . رویه Minimax
. . . هرس βα
. فرااکتشافات در بهینه سازی ترکیبی
. . تعاریف اولیه
. . طبقه بندی فرااکتشافات
. . روشهای خط سیر
. . . جستجوی محلی پایه
. . . آنیلینگ شبیه سازی شده
. . . جستجوی ممنوع
. . . روشهای جستجوی محلی کاوشگرانه
. . . . GRASP
. . . . جستجوی همسایگی متغیر
. . . . جستجوی محلی هدایت شده
. . . . جستجوی محلی تکراری
. . روشهای مبنی بر جمعیت
. . . محاسبه تکاملی
. . . . جستجوی پخشی و اتصال مجدد مسیر
. . . . الگوریتم های تقریب توزیع
. . . بهینه سازی گروه مورچه ها(ACO)
. . دیدگاه متمرکزسازی و متنوع سازی
. . . متمرکزسازی و متنوع سازی
. . . کنترل استراتژیک متمرکزسازی و متنوع سازی
. . . ترکیب فرااکتشافات
. خلاصه و نتیجه گیری
. مراجع
مقاله ترجمه شده با موضوع هماهنگی در زنجیره تأمین با به کارگیری قرارداد تأخیر در پرداخت دو سطحی: مطالعه درباره تقاضای وابسته به مدت تأخیر کلمات کلیدی : مقاله ترجمه شده رشته مهندسی صنایع مقاله ترجمه شده آماده رشته مهندسی…
پاورپوینت بررسی بیماری های مادرزادی قلب دانلود دانلود پاورپوینت با موضوع بررسی بیماری های مادرزادی قلب، در قالب ppt و در 59 اسلاید، قابل ویرایش، شامل: تعریف بیماری های مادرزادی قلب پری والانس اتیولوژی مشاوره ژنتیک (Genetic counseling) شایع…
گسترش منابع انسانی و نقش آی تی در آن منابع انسانی دانلود مقاله توسعه منابع انسانی دانلود مقاله نقش فناوری اطلاعات در توسعه منابع انسانی دانلود مقالات رشته مدیریت دانلود مقالات مدیریت دانلود مقاله گسترش منابع انسانی و نقش آی…
تحقیقات آزمایشی و شبیه سازی عددی جریان در لوله گرداب لوله ورتکس جریان در لوله ورتکس بررسی عملکرد لوله ورتکس بررسی تجربی جریان در لوله ورتکس شبیه سازی عددی جریان در لوله ورتکس دانلود پایان نامه جریان در لوله ورتکس…
بررسی کامل نظریه های وابستگی به مواد کلمات کلیدی : مصرف مواد در ایران مبنای نظری وابستگی به مواد نظریه های وابستگی به مواد عوامل تاثیر گذار بر مصرف مواد رویکردها ی درمانی وابستگی به مواد پایان نامه سوء مصرف…
دانلود پاورپوینت کتاب روش تحقیق در علوم انسانی پاورپوینت کتاب روش تحقیق در علوم انسانی پاورپوینت کتاب روش تحقیق در علوم انسانی حافظ نیا پاورپوینت کتاب روش تحقیق در علوم انسانی ملکیان پاورپوینت کتاب روش تحقیق در علوم انسانی دلاور…